Record/origin: The term "inch" was derived in the Latin device "uncia" which equated to "a person-twelfth" of the Roman foot.
An inch can be a size device normally used in The usa and, once in a while, in the United Kingdom. It can be described to be a twelth (1/twelfth) of the foot. The inch is Typically subdivided into fractions of the inch such as the ½, ¼ and ⅛.

There are already a number of different standards with the inch in the past, with the current definition remaining based to the Intercontinental garden. Among the earliest definitions from the inch was based on barleycorns, exactly where an inch was equivalent on the length of 3 grains of dry, round barley put finish-to-close.
